Boars take Rangers to extra Innings at Rice

By Joe Cantrell, 05/07/17, 10:30PM EDT

Share

Rice Field, Miamisburg, Ohio was the site of the first game of the 2017 season between the Rangers and the Wild Boars.                    

The Rangers ever relentless in scoring went to work early scoring 2 right away in the first while pitching stood tall and held the Boars scoreless in the bottom of the first. Head Coach Jonmarc Lippencott always has a game plan together for the Boars and was able to hold the Boars scoreless through most of the game with great pitching and some very decent field work by the Ranger's infield and outfield.

The Rangers added to their lead in the 2nd with another run while the Boars managed to push one across of their own. The Rangers added 3 in the 4th and 2 in the 7th and led 9-1 as the Boars came to bat in the 8th after holding the Rangers scoreless in the top half of the 8th. The Boars set to work scoring twice  in the 8th to trail 9-3.  

The Boars retired the Rangers without a run in the 9th after Garret Copas snagged a fly ball in left, KJ Jimison  went 5-3 to record the 2nd out, and first baseman Joe Cantrell went to Pitcher Brandon Lucas for the 3rd out.

The Boars came up with their backs against the wall.  Kenny Faulks reached on an error and Grant Mink reached base on a single. Coty Hahn hit the ball back to the pitcher but a throwing/fielding mistake allowed Grant Mink to be safe at 2nd as Coty reached 1st on the fielders choice. Markus Hall then hit a single scoring Faulks and Mink. Brandon Lucas then hit the ball allowing  Coty Hahn to score. Doug Adkins then hit a ball to left field after flirting with the line a couple times that fell for a double  scoring Lucas. Doug Adkins advanced on a past ball and scored on Zach Carroll's single. Carroll was then thrown out attempting to steal and Copas drew a walk.  Greg Pfeiffer then hit a shot into the outfield and Copas wound up on third and Pfeiffer safe at 2nd. Travis Knight grounded out for the 3rd out.  When the dust had settled the Boars had pushed across 6 and tied the score and we were headed to extra innings. 

In the 10th,  walks hurt the Boars giving up 2 before recording a strikeout. Then a hit batter in the 10th, and costly hit that allowed the Rangers to score 3 times before the Rangers were retired they now led 12-9.

The Boars started the inning again with Faulks who flied out. Grant Mink got hit by a pitch and Coty Hahn grounds out advancing Mink.  Markus Hall again hits a single scoring Mink but Jackson Millard flies out to end the 10th and give the Rangers the win.

Grant Mink earns defensive player of the game for 1 PO and 2 assist and the snagging of a line drive that was headed for the outfield and possible extra bases and recorded 0 errors.
